Journalists from the AFP news agency have seen Chinese projectiles being fired and sent into the Taiwan Strait. The projectiles were fired from a military installation in Pingtan, according to the journalists. Clouds of smoke and the sound of explosions were then reported. Shells are being fired in six zones around the island, The Guardian reports. It happens after the Chinese authorities announced that they were going to use live ammunition during their exercises around the island. The Chinese today started the largest ever military exercises in the waters around Taiwan after the visit of Congress leader Nancy Pelosi (82) yesterday. The Chinese will surround the entire island militarily, and have announced the exercise will last until Sunday. – We came to make it crystal clear that we will not let Taiwan down, Pelosi said when she met Taiwan’s President Tsai Ing-wen. Pelosi is America’s third most powerful politician and speaker of Congress. The fact that such a high-ranking politician from the US is visiting the island provoked the Chinese, who issued strong warnings against the visit. – We are supporters of the status quo, we do not want anything to happen to Taiwan by force, Pelosi said and clearly showed that she does not want China to become more involved in the island. China believes Taiwan rightfully belongs to them. China has begun a record-breaking military exercise around the island of Taiwan.
